– Step by step -- How to make games with MUGEN?
- Download and install MUGEN: The first thing you should do is download the MUGEN program from its official website. Once downloaded, follow the instructions to install it on your computer.
- Get the characters and settings: Search the internet for character and scenario files that you want to include in your game. Make sure you download MUGEN compatible files
- Copy the files to the corresponding folders: Once the character and stage files have been downloaded, copy them to the corresponding folders within the MUGEN directory. Generally, the characters go in the "chars" folder and the stages in the "stages" folder.
- Edit the “def.def” file: Open the "def.def" file with a text editor and make the necessary settings, such as including characters and scenarios, as well as configuring controls and game modes.
- Change the screenpack: If you want to customize the appearance of your game, you can change the screenpack to one that suits your tastes. Simply download the screenpack of your choice and replace the corresponding files in the screenpack folder.
- Test and adjust: Once you have made all the settings, it is time to test your game. Play a few games to make sure everything is working correctly. If you encounter any problems, return to editing files to make the necessary adjustments.
- Share your game: Congratulations, you've created your own game with MUGEN! If you wish, you can share it with other players on forums or specialized websites, so they can enjoy your creation.

How can I create my own characters in MUGEN?
- Download a MUGEN-compatible character creation program, such as Fighter Factory.
- Open the program and familiarize yourself with the sprite and movement editing tools.
- Import or create your own sprites for the character, including their punches, kicks, and special abilities.
- Export the finished character in a MUGEN compatible format and add it to the game.

How can I add special moves to characters in MUGEN?
- Open your character definition file in a text editor or a specialized program such as Fighter Factory.
- Adds new lines of code for special moves, specifying input commands and visual and sound effects.
- Test the moves in the game to make sure they work correctly and look as you expect.
- Adjust and refine moves as needed to improve playability and aesthetics.
